Re: 16 Bit - Chainsaw Calligraphy

Posted: Wed Dec 02, 2009 2:42 am
by spkta
i had best success by using fm synthesis... sin v sin... different octaves played simultaneously. use a scream filter with a high cutoff and high saturation. then bitcrush and overdrive.

good luck, it's very difficult sometimes.
